Output 3508e4c7908ced75c60070135b30ccbe08614c77e21acb8a4a2a696a00030f88:1

value
96000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 420371be50c2c31b45159c384847ec29dadd05fb OP_EQUAL
address
MDvCxQVb2UdxoHziB2oV2zq3zQT9K1dN9o
transaction
3508e4c7908ced75c60070135b30ccbe08614c77e21acb8a4a2a696a00030f88
spent
true